How big of an inverter do I need to run a small fridge?

To determine the size of inverter you will need to run a small fridge, you need to first consider what type of fridge you are running. If you have a conventional fridge with a compressor, then you will need to get an inverter that can produce at least 300 watts of continuous power.

If you have a smaller fridge that only has a fan component, you can look for an inverter that can produce about 75-100 watts of continuous power.

It is also important to calculate the start-up surge of your fridge in order to determine the power requirements that you need to look for when selecting an inverter. Usually refrigerators require 2 to 4 times their normal operating power upon startup.

This is because the compressor and other components need additional power to get up and running during the initial startup period. To properly power your fridge, the inverter you choose should be able to produce 2-4 times the continuous load.

Finally, verify the number of watts you need by measuring the energy usage of your fridge. You can find this information on the nameplate located on the back of your fridge. Once you have this figure you can choose an inverter that is rated for above this wattage.

In conclusion, the size of inverter you need to run a small fridge will depend on the type of fridge you have and the power consumption of your particular model. Make sure you calculate the start-up surge and select an inverter that is above this wattage for the best results.
